This research investigates the early development of the pancreas from precursor cells, focusing on the role of a novel signaling factor named Shirin. Understanding these processes may lead to advances in diabetes treatment and cell-replacement therapies.
A fundamental question in developmental biology is how a specialized tissue or organ originates from a pluripotent precursor cell in the embryo.
The central aim of my research is to understand how and when the pancreas is progressively specified during embryogenesis.
The pancreas controls two crucial functions in our body: the production of digestive enzymes and the regulation of blood sugar.
